Energy — Emissions (CO2eq) in New Zealand
New Zealand: Energy — Emissions (CO2eq) was 33,466 kt in 2023. ▲ Rising
Energy — Emissions (CO2eq) in New Zealand, 1961–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
In 2023, energy — emissions (co2eq) in New Zealand stood at 33,466 kt.
The figure is up 3.7% on the previous year and down 5.9% over ten years.
Over the whole period, energy — emissions (co2eq) in New Zealand peaked at 36,816 kt in 2014 and was at its lowest, 11,647 kt, in 1962.
New Zealand ranks 75th of 200 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 63 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
